Cranberry Pecan Cream Cheese Stuffed Celery

Cranberry Pecan Cream Cheese Stuffed Celery: A Flavorful Delight

A quick and easy gluten-free appetizer, Cranberry Pecan Cream Cheese Stuffed Celery combines creamy cheese with sweet-tart cranberries and crunchy pecans.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Chilling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Appetizers
Cuisine: American
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

For the Filling
  • 8 oz Cream Cheese Room temperature for easy mixing.
  • 1/2 cup Cranberries Chopped; can substitute with chopped apricots or raisins.
  • 1/2 cup Pecans Can substitute with walnuts or almonds.
  • 1 tsp Vanilla Extract Optional.
  • 2 tbsp Powdered Sugar Optional for sweetness.
For the Celery
  • 4 stalks Celery Sticks Cut into 3-inch sticks.

Equipment

  • Mixing bowl
  • Piping bag or small spoon
  • Cutting board
  • Knife

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Wash the celery stalks under cold running water and pat them dry. Cut the celery into 3-inch sticks.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ine room temperature cream cheese, chopped cranberries, and pecans. Add vanilla extract and blend until smooth.
  3. Fill each celery stick with the cranberry pecan cream cheese mixture using a spoon or piping bag.
  4. Place the stuffed celery on a platter and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ow flavors to meld.
  5. Serve chilled, optionally garnished with chopped pecans or fresh herbs.

Notes

Use room temperature cream cheese for the smoothest filling. You can prepare the filling a day in advance to save time.
